Basic Photography
Basic Photography
Step 1 - Select P Mode
This section details the basic steps involved in taking pictures in P (auto) mode.
In this automatic, "point-and-shoot" mode, the majority of camera settings are
controlled by the camera in response to shooting conditions, producing optimal
results in most situations.
Rotate the mode dial to P
Turn the camera on
The power-on lamp will light and the monitor
will display a welcome screen (Q 89). The
camera is ready to shoot when the monitor
shows the view through the camera lens.

Nikon Coolpix 4600 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Megapixel4 MP
Sensor typeCCD
Image sensor size1/2.5 \
Optical zoom3 x
Focal length range5.7 - 17.1 mm
Metering256-segment matrix
InterfaceUSB
Minimum RAM64 MB
Built-in flashYes
Camera shutter speed4-1/3000 s
Minimum storage drive space60 MB
Minimum system requirementsCD-ROM Display: 800 x 600
Compatible operating systemsMac OS X (10.1.5) Windows XP Home Edition / Professional, Windows 2000 Professional, Windows Me, Windows 98SE
Focal length (35mm film equivalent)34 - 102 mm
Viewfinder typeOptical
Internal memory14 MB
Compatible memory cardssd
Display diagonal1.8 \
Display resolution (numeric)80.000 pixels
I/O portsVideo (NTSC / PAL) out
Bundled softwarePictureProject
Camera playbackSlide show
Self-timer delay10 s
Playback zoom (max)10 x
Motion JPEG frame rate30 fps
Maximum video resolution640 x 480 pixels
Product colorSilver
Battery type2xLR6 / EN-MH1 / ZR6 / FR6
Battery technologyAlkaline
Power requirementsEN-MH1, LR6, ZR6, FR6, EH-62B
Flash modesAuto, Red-eye reduction
Focus adjustmentAuto
